package feign;
import static feign.FeignException.errorReading;
import static feign.Util.ensureClosed;
import feign.Logger.Level;
import feign.codec.Decoder;
import feign.codec.ErrorDecoder;
import java.io.IOException;
import java.lang.reflect.Type;
/**
* The response handler that is used to provide synchronous support on top of standard response
* handling
*/
public class ResponseHandler {
private final Level logLevel;
private final Logger logger;
private final Decoder decoder;
private final ErrorDecoder errorDecoder;
private final boolean dismiss404;
private final boolean closeAfterDecode;
private final boolean decodeVoid;
private final ResponseInterceptor.Chain executionChain;
public ResponseHandler(Level logLevel, Logger logger, Decoder decoder, ErrorDecoder errorDecoder,
boolean dismiss404, boolean closeAfterDecode, boolean decodeVoid,
ResponseInterceptor.Chain executionChain) {
super();
this.logLevel = logLevel;
this.logger = logger;
this.decoder = decoder;
this.errorDecoder = errorDecoder;
this.dismiss404 = dismiss404;
this.closeAfterDecode = closeAfterDecode;
this.decodeVoid = decodeVoid;
this.executionChain = executionChain;
}
public Object handleResponse(String configKey,
Response response,
Type returnType,
long elapsedTime)
throws Exception {
try {
response = logAndRebufferResponseIfNeeded(configKey, response, elapsedTime);
return executionChain.next(
new InvocationContext(configKey, decoder, errorDecoder, dismiss404, closeAfterDecode,
decodeVoid, response, returnType));
} catch (final IOException e) {
if (logLevel != Level.NONE) {
logger.logIOException(configKey, logLevel, e, elapsedTime);
}
throw errorReading(response.request(), response, e);
} catch (Exception e) {
ensureClosed(response.body());
throw e;
}
}
private Response logAndRebufferResponseIfNeeded(String configKey,
Response response,
long elapsedTime)
throws IOException {
if (logLevel == Level.NONE) {
return response;
}
return logger.logAndRebufferResponse(configKey, logLevel, response, elapsedTime);
}
}
